    How Much Money Required for Rent Agreement

    When it comes to renting a property, a rent agreement is a crucial document. It acts as a legal contract between the landlord and the tenant, outlining the terms and conditions of the tenancy. As a prospective tenant, you may be wondering how much money is required for a rent agreement. In this article, we will explore some of the costs associated with rent agreements and what you need to know before signing one.

    First and foremost, it is important to note that the cost of a rent agreement varies from state to state and even from city to city. In some areas, the landlord is responsible for paying for the rent agreement, while in others, the tenant is expected to cover the cost. In most cases, the cost is nominal and ranges from a few hundred to a few thousand rupees.

    Apart from the cost of the rent agreement itself, there may be other expenses associated with it. For example, in some cases, landlords may require tenants to pay a security deposit, which is typically one or two months` rent. This deposit acts as a safeguard for the landlord in case the tenant damages the property or fails to pay rent. It is important to note that the security deposit is not a replacement for rent and is refundable at the end of the tenancy, provided that the tenant has fulfilled all the terms of the lease agreement.

    In addition to the security deposit, there may be other costs associated with renting a property, such as maintenance charges, parking fees, and utility bills. These expenses should be clearly outlined in the rent agreement so that both the landlord and tenant are aware of their obligations.

    When it comes to signing a rent agreement, it is crucial to read the document carefully and understand all the terms and conditions. If you have any questions or concerns, do not hesitate to ask the landlord or seek legal advice. Remember, a rent agreement is a legally binding document, and signing it means that you agree to all the terms and conditions outlined in the document.

    In conclusion, the cost of a rent agreement varies depending on the location and the terms of the lease. While the cost is typically nominal, it is essential to understand all the expenses associated with renting a property, including the security deposit and other related charges. Reading and understanding the terms of the rent agreement is crucial to avoid any surprises or disputes in the future. Always ensure that you have clarity on all aspects of the tenancy before signing the rent agreement.
